  • 00:12 : First major orchestral swell introduces the grand, majestic theme with brass and choir-like textures.
  • 00:46 : Powerful dynamic build leading to a soaring emotional peak with full orchestra; ideal for a climax or reveal.
  • 01:05 : Shift to a lighter, playful section featuring sparkling woodwinds (flute/piccolo) and pizzicato strings, adding contrast and charm.
  • 01:20 : Adventurous, rhythmic build-up begins with driving percussion and heroic brass fanfares.
  • 01:33 : Peak of the adventurous theme with strong brass melody and full orchestral support.
  • 01:52 : Gentle, lyrical interlude featuring solo woodwind (oboe/clarinet?) and softer strings, providing emotional depth.
  • 02:29 : Massive, emotionally charged orchestral hit leading into the final heroic statement of the main theme.
  • 02:43 : Sweeping, broad rendition of the main theme with full orchestra and choir, conveying hope and grandeur.
  • 02:57 : Start of the grand finale sequence with triumphant brass calls and responses over powerful percussion.
  • 03:17 : Decrescendo into a peaceful, reflective outro featuring gentle woodwinds and strings, bringing the piece to a calm close.

Right off the bat, "The Princess In The Big Castle" presents itself as a high-caliber orchestral piece, exceptionally well-suited for the library music market, particularly targeting film, television, and gaming sectors. The production quality is immediately apparent – this isn't a bedroom synth mock-up; it feels like a full, breathing orchestra captured with clarity and depth. The mix is balanced, allowing the powerful brass fanfares and soaring string melodies to take center stage without overwhelming the more delicate woodwind passages or nuanced percussion.

The composition itself demonstrates a strong understanding of cinematic scoring conventions. It opens with a gentle, almost reflective quality, hinting at the 'Princess' element – perhaps a touch of innocence or melancholy – before blossoming into a truly majestic and sweeping theme strongly evoking the 'Big Castle'. This dynamic range is a huge asset for media use. We have moments of quiet introspection that could underscore dialogue or pensive scenes, contrasted with powerful, heroic swells perfect for establishing shots, dramatic reveals, action sequences, or title cards.

The instrumentation is classic orchestral fare, executed effectively. The strings provide lush emotional bedding and carry soaring melodic lines. The brass section delivers powerful, regal fanfares and dramatic stings, essential for adding weight and grandeur. Woodwinds offer moments of lightness, charm, and intimacy, particularly noticeable in the middle sections, adding character and preventing the piece from becoming solely bombastic. The percussion adds rhythmic drive and punctuates the key dramatic moments effectively, including tympani rolls and cymbal crashes that enhance the epic feel. There's also a subtle but effective use of choral textures, adding another layer of grandeur and emotional resonance.

From a usability perspective, this track is a goldmine for specific briefs. Its inherent narrative quality makes it ideal for fantasy settings, historical dramas, adventure films, or anything requiring a sense of scale, wonder, and emotional weight. Think sweeping landscape shots, royal processions, character introductions for noble figures, heartfelt emotional climaxes, or even the main theme for a fantasy RPG. It could easily score a trailer, building excitement effectively. Beyond film, its elegance lends itself to high-end corporate presentations, prestigious award ceremonies, or even sophisticated advertising campaigns looking to evoke tradition, quality, or aspiration. The clear structure, with distinct sections and varying intensity levels, also makes it easy for editors to cut and loop specific parts to fit different scene lengths or moods. It avoids overly modern elements, giving it a timeless, classic cinematic feel that won't quickly sound dated. This is a robust, professionally crafted orchestral cue with broad appeal in the cinematic and epic genres.
